ALEXANDRIA, Va., May 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,619,063, issued on May 5, was assigned to Canon K.K. (Tokyo).
"Lens, ocular optical system, and image display apparatus" was invented by Takashi Torii (Kanagawa, Japan).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A lens including ejector pin marks formed at contacting portions with ejector pins used in molding, with a first side including the ejector pin marks and a second side not including the ejector pin marks. The ejector pin marks are located outside of an optical effective diameter on the first side, and at least one of the ejector pin marks on the first side is located inside an optical effective diameter on the second side."
